Data: Bitcoin Spot ETF yesterday's total net inflow was 94.3361 million US dollars, the first net inflow after a net outflow for the past 8 days.
ChainCatcher message, according to SoSoValue data, the total net inflow of BTCSpot ETF on yesterday (February 28th, Eastern Time) was 94.3361 million US dollars. Yesterday, Grayscale ETF GBTC had a net outflow of 33.2764 million US dollars, with a total historical outflow of 22.295 billion US dollars. Grayscale BTC Mini Trust ETF BTC had a net inflow of 5.5901 million US dollars on the day, with a total historical net inflow of 1.051 billion US dollars for Grayscale BTC Mini Trust BTC. Yesterday, the BTCSpot ETF with the highest single-day net inflows was the ARKB ETF from Ark Invest and 21Shares, with a single-day net inflow of $194 million, bringing ARKB’s total historical net inflows to $2.726 billion. This was followed by the Fidelity ETF FBTC, with a single-day net inflow of $176 million, bringing FBTC’s total historical net inflows to $11.764 billion. As of the time of writing, the total net asset value of BTCSpot ETF is $95.379 billion, with an ETF net asset ratio (proportion of market value to total BTC market value) of 5.71%, and historical net inflows totaling $36.942 billion.
